Hi everyone,

Is there a way to change a origin plan location of an already existing assembly? this old assembly was made with a not cetralized origin plane for some reason and i wanted to change that without having to re-assembly it.

Depends on how the assembly was made.  If everything was constrained to the first pieces, sure, you can redo the constraints on that or unground it and constrain it where it needs to go.

 

If some things are grounded to the origin planes and others grounded and/or constrained to themselves, etc...you can redo it, but it'll take a good deal longer.

 

There's not a 'relocate the 0,0,0 point button.

right click on cubo volante and uncheck "grounded"..

Then you can use ground and root if you want or just manually create the constraints as necessary to the origin planes from whatever part you want centered..

If it's all properly constrained, you can just unground the root component and then use this command to put the component that you want at the centre of the origin. 

This also relies on that component being modelled properly around the origin.
